MICK HELLMAN

Founder & Managing Partner

Mick Hellman is a Founder, Managing Partner, and member of the Investment and Management Committees. Prior to establishing HMI in late 2008, Mick spent most of his career at Hellman & Friedman, LLC where he was a Managing Director and a member of the Investment Committee. Mick started his career at Hellman & Friedman in the financial services vertical, working on investments in the money management sector. Mick founded Hellman & Friedman’s software and logistics practices and established the firm’s Hong Kong office. He was instrumental in Hellman & Friedman’s investments in Blackbaud, Hongkong International Terminals and Mitchell International. Notably, Mick served as Chairman of Blackbaud, Inc. (NYSE: BLKB), from 1999 to 2009. Prior to joining Hellman & Friedman in 1987, Mick worked as a Financial Analyst at Salomon Brothers in San Francisco in the Corporate Finance Department.

Currently, Mick serves as a member of the Board of Directors of Hall Capital Partners LLC. In addition, Mick is currently a trustee of the Rosenberg Foundation, the USA Cycling Foundation, and the Hellman Foundation. Prior board involvement include: SFJazz Organization; Oh!media (ASX: OML); Osterweis Capital Management; LPL Financial Holdings Inc. (NASDAQ: LPLA); Asia Alternatives Management LLC.; UC Berkeley Foundation; Blackbaud; Hongkong International Terminals; Mitchell International; Foxcroft School (Board Chair and Chair of the Investment Committee); and the Bay Area Discovery Museum.

Mick received a B.A. in Economics with High Distinction from the University of California at Berkeley and an M.B.A. with Distinction from Harvard Business School. Mick and his wife have five grown children and live in the San Francisco Bay Area. Mick also performs drums and vocals with his children, sisters, nieces, and nephews in several Americana bands, playing in Bay Area bars and nightclubs.
